C-FHRD is a 1990 Dehavilland DHC-8-103 (2 engines) based in Calgary, Alberta, listed on the Transport Canada Civil Aircraft Register (serial 239).

Where C-FHRD is, and how to track it

Calgary, AlbertaTransport Canada records the base city, so this marker shows the province rather than the exact field.

C-FHRD transmits ADS-B under the 24-bit address C0143A. Trackers key on that address rather than the tail number, so it finds the aircraft even on flights flown under a different callsign. Transport Canada assigns the address against the registration, so it changes if the aircraft is re-registered.

Most private aircraft are on the ground most of the time — if a tracker shows nothing, it is very likely parked rather than missing.
